Hotel Lucia

400 SW Broadway, Portland, USA
Downtown
127 Rooms
Modern Design & Lively
What it all comes down to, in the end, is two things: personality and service. Personality because you want a hotel stay to be a memorable experience, not just a comfortable one. And service because personality without warmth is just eccentricity — and you want those memories to be pleasant ones. So if Portland’s Hotel Lucia is neither the most outrageously experimental of design hotels, nor the most lavishly opulent of luxury hotels, know that it’s strong in the areas that ultimately matter most.

In the Lucia’s case the personality comes from a confident and rather grown-up visual identity, some charming and slightly quirky historical architecture, a location in Portland’s increasingly vibrant downtown, and a first-rate collection of black-and-white prints from David Hume Kennerly, a highly regarded local photographer. Add to this a selection of rooms and suites which are comfortable and efficient (if not always exactly oversized) and you’re well on your way.

What brings it together, in the end, is the service, which combines genuine Northwestern friendliness with an impressive can-do mindset: “Make It So” is something of a motto for Hotel Lucia’s staff. No less warm is the atmosphere in Imperial, the restaurant, where painstakingly sourced Northwestern dishes issue forth from the wood-fired grill; or Portland Penny Diner, a much more casual (though scarcely less tasty) counter-service option.
